Will Young admits drastic action he almost took with sledgehammer to get out of Strictly
Will Young has revealed he considered breaking his own leg with a sledgehammer to get out of BBC’s Strictly Come Dancing in 2016. The singer, 45, has candidly spoken about suffering panic attacks “24 hours a day” before he pulled out of the competition.
